About Us

Picture
We are a car show to raise money for charities organised by the Rotary Club of Uxbridge Autoshow Limited (crn:5101603) for petrol heads, car enthusiasts and their families featuring up to 2000 classic, modern, custom and kit cars, plus commercial and military vehicles.

If you aren't into cars we also have a music stage with local bands playing throughout the day and a large fun fair for the kids (and adults).

The show has been running since 1984 and to date has raised over £619,000 for local and national charities.
